A DIY idea: Is it clever or stupid?

I have two pairs of shoes for offroad; Fizik Artica X5 for winter and Fizik Vento X3 for summer. The Articas are perfect for their job, but in summer I'm still getting really hot & sweaty on summer rides, so I'd like a little more ventilation.

Would it be crazy to drill a couple of holes in the toes of the Vento X3 to allow a bit more airflow through? They have a very sturdy toe cap (sturdier than I'll ever need, I'm not kicking rocks around) whilst further back on the upper there are lots of little perforations. I don't mind the risk of occasional mud ingress into the toe, as my off-road riding tends to be more gravel than mud and I hose the shoes out when necessary. Is there anything else that could go wrong?
